The Measurement Analytics Partner (MAP) Manager is a leadership position within the LinkedIn Customer Science team. This person will work with internal and external stakeholders to advise clients and influence the industry with LinkedIn’s POV on marketing measurement. The successful candidate will lead and manage a team of individual contributors to drive LinkedIn preferred measurement methods and best practice, whilst encouraging first and third-party product adoption at scale.
This person will be comfortable talking about a combination of techniques and measurement strategies that drive insights and business results for advertisers. Furthermore, this role will engage with the broader industry ecosystem with the aim of accelerating good measurement practice. Conclusions from their team’s work will showcase what good measurement is and how a client can act upon it to drive business impact.
Our ideal candidate will have a passion for marketing analytics, critical thinking skills and the ability to build deep relationships at senior marketing and other C-level roles. This person will need to be able to work cross-functionally with advertisers, sales teams and other members of the Customer Science Organization.
This role will also require working closely with Product Marketing, Product, Business Development, R&D and other cross functional teams to develop or pilot new methodologies and to aid in shaping our product roadmap. Remit for this role will be across North America and specifically serve our Enterprise group. Although this role will cover the Enterprise Accounts group in North America, we expect the right candidate to have an ability to strategically think through connection points with their Global counterparts who work on the same accounts in other regions, leading to greater business results and client satisfaction (where applicable). Responsibilities
- Manage a complex set of client relationships across industry and client groups, functions, and brands to drive our measurement objectives
- Coach and develop a team of Measurement Analytics Partners of varying skill levels to deliver excellent measurement work, identifying opportunities for progression and nurturing future leaders
- Push clients to measure true business value by building and operationalizing "learning agendas" that highlight how a client can improve business outcomes by employing better measurement techniques and drive client, vertical, and industry adoption of preferred measurement methodologies, products, and approaches in support of the learning agenda
- Implement and monitor against a set of performance indicators the progress of each account and scaling of measurement strategy
- Develop and nurture relationships with key sales leadership partners and share knowledge and best practice globally
- Play a strategic role in developing the cross-platform and cross-media measurement approaches and agendas for large advertisers and vertical categories
- Communicate complex research results
- Provide feedback to and collaborate with Product Marketing, Product, R&D, and Partnerships to identify opportunities for new features, products, and partnerships
- Drive client engagement around measurement innovation, including measurement alphas and beta
